Texas continues to be a magnet for individuals and businesses looking to capitalize on its pro-growth environment. With over 1,000new residents moving to Texas daily, the demand for housing has far exceeded supply. Cities like Dallas-Fort Worth, Austin, and Houston are among the fastest-growing metropolitan areas in the country, further increasing the need for new developments and pushing land values higher.
The Texas Triangle is facing a severe shortage of entitled land, which has made pre-development land investments a prime opportunity for investors. As more homebuilders seek ready-to-build land, those who can navigate the entitlement process stand to see significant appreciation. Major developers such as Lennar, D.R. Horton, and KB Home are actively expanding their footprints, leading to heightened demand for entitled land.
Beyond the demand for housing, Texas ranks among the top states for job creation and economic growth, with a GDP surpassing $1.46 trillion. Its business-friendly policies, no state income tax, and robust employment sectors continue to attract a diverse group of investors looking for sustainable real estate opportunities.
One of the most lucrative yet underutilized real estate investment strategies is land entitlement. This involves obtaining the necessary zoning approvals and permits to develop raw land into residential or commercial properties. Investors who engage in land entitlement create substantial value, as entitled land typically appreciates 2-3x compared to raw land. This process requires patience and expertise but offers a low-risk, high-return investment opportunity since no actual construction is required.
Successful land entitlement investors leverage off-market deal sourcing, allowing them to acquire properties before they reach the public market. Early access to deals enables investors to negotiate favorable pricing and gain exclusive opportunities. Additionally, these investments often have a 12-24 month cycle, making them attractive for investors seeking quicker liquidity compared to full-scale developments. By exiting before vertical construction begins, investors can mitigate exposure to market fluctuations, rising construction costs, and regulatory uncertainties.
A prime example of this strategy is acquiring raw land in a high-growth metro like Dallas or Austin, where the entitlement process can significantly increase land value. By navigating zoning approvals, infrastructure planning, and securing permits, investors can unlock higher returns with reduced capital at risk.
Multifamily investments have become a staple in long-term wealth-building strategies. The rise in homeownership costs, high interest rates, and shifting lifestyle preferences has led to a surge in rental demand. Texas’s growing population continues to fuel this demand, making build-to-rent and multifamily housing one of the most attractive investment categories.
By participating in Co-Partnerships, investors can gain access to large-scale multifamily projects while sharing risks and rewards with experienced developers. Institutional investors are increasingly targeting multifamily properties in Texas, further solidifying their position as a reliable, cash-flow-generating asset class. Unlike single-family rentals, multifamily investments provide built-in diversification, as properties generate income from multiple tenants, reducing overall vacancy risk.
Another major benefit of multifamily investments is scalability. Investors can expand their portfolios more efficiently by adding multiple units under one management system, creating operational efficiencies and increasing rental yields. Furthermore, Texas cities are experiencing a rise in luxury multifamily developments, as high-income renters look for premium living spaces with modern amenities.
Value-add real estate investing involves purchasing underperforming properties and implementing strategic improvements to increase their value. This can include renovations, rebranding, improved property management, and lease optimization to enhance rental income and overall property appreciation.
Investors can unlock significant long-term gains by leveraging refinancing and appreciation, allowing them to reinvest in additional properties and compound their wealth. Identifying undervalued properties in high-growth submarkets enables investors to benefit from both forced and natural appreciation.
Modernizing older properties to align with current tenant preferences increases occupancy rates and allows landlords to charge premium rents. With an increased focus on amenities, smart technology, and sustainability, value-add investors who incorporate these features into their properties can achieve higher rental premiums and tenant retention rates.
